About

Ivan Ivanov is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Electrical and Electronic Engineering and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ics. According to data from OpenAlex, Ivan Ivanov has authored 13 papers receiving a total of 915 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 11 papers in Materials Chemistry, 7 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ering and 4 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ics. Recurrent topics in Ivan Ivanov's work include Graphene research and applications (9 papers), Quantum Dots Synthesis And Properties (2 papers) and Carbon Nanotubes in Composites (2 papers). Ivan Ivanov is often cited by papers focused on Graphene research and applications (9 papers), Quantum Dots Synthesis And Properties (2 papers) and Carbon Nanotubes in Composites (2 papers). Ivan Ivanov collaborates with scholars based in Germany, United States and Spain. Ivan Ivanov's co-authors include Mischa Bonn, Yongquan Qu, Xiangfeng Duan, Yu Huang, Hua Zhang, Yujing Li, Hai I. Wang, Dmitry Turchinovich, Kläus Müllen and Simon Bretschneider and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of the American Chemical Society, Advanced Materials and Angewandte Chemie International Edition.
